Over heating when i turn on my car and after about 10-15minutes my amp is hot as microwave popcorn. It never did that until after i had bout 6 months

Have you changed the speakers? Usualy an overheating amp means the resitance on the speakers is too low. If your amp is only 4 ohm stable, and you have two 4 ohm speakers hooked together, you are running a 2 ohm load. Hope this helps.

No heat

If you remove the outer cover of the microwave, you will see a magnatron. Usually on the RHSide of the micro. This magnatron will need replacing. On the magnatron,is an over temp.sensor. If this gets hot excessively, then all will stop untill it cools down. This indicates magnatron is faulty.(Assuming cooling fan runs when micro program is selected and switched on). Honestly, i would suggest caution if undergoing this repair as the voltages are extreemly high and there are proceedures to repair theese units. Testing equiptment a must.

Microwave Turntable

Microwave popcorn gets VERY hot while cooking. Even though the turntable is made of temepred glass, intense heat applied in the same spot over and over can weaken the molecular structure of the glass. After so many expansions and contractions, it will crack because fatigue will cause some molecules to expand less than others, creating stress. This is yet another reason I recommend to my customers that they place the food off-center on the tray - not in the center. The oven also heats better when the food is off-center because the food is more thoroughly exposed to the microwave energy. Until you get a new tray, the photo below can help you.
